Regrouping Movie Images
When you record a movie, the camera automatically groups four images that make up the movie. Transferring a movie to a personal computer causes its images to become ungrouped. If you download the movie back to the camera, you will be unable to play it back as a movie unless you use the following procedure to re-group the images.
